Contents:
What are
workshops
and
seminars
? -- Logistics : Date, time, place -- Creating a budget -- Establishing your team of professionals -- Funding, sponsors, and donations -- Get ready to deliver -- Marketing the seminar and workshop to the right audience -- Deliver -- Working with attendees -- Mistakes and disasters and how to avoid them -- Evaluating the seminar and workshop success -- What you
need
to do if you are setting up an event, workshop, seminar, or
conference
planning business.
Summary:
"In this new book, you will learn the ins and outs of planning a workshop, from general decisions about how long the event will last to the minute details such as where each person will check in and sit. This
complete
guide
will teach you how to effectively target and communicate with your audience so you can give you attendees the information they were missing. You will learn about the basics of leading a training program, such as what characteristics you should portray to show your authority and credibility, as well as the general structural elements of a workshop seminar, and
conference
. This comprehensive book will help you define the reason why you are holding a workshop, and will teach you to succinctly create an objective for your participants so that you are destined for success. You will even learn how to evaluate and measure your success during and after the event to prove your true effectiveness and determine your program's strengths and weaknesses. Filled with information about how to build a budget, planning, scheduling and get funding for your workshop, this book addresses the financial aspect of holding an hour, day, or weekend workshop so that you can adequately allocate your money. This
guide
will teach you
everything
you
need
to
know
to
plan
,
promote
, and
present
a
conference
." --Back cover.
